Job description

We’re seeking a future team member for the role of Vice President, Infrastructure Engineering to join our Engineering team. This role is located in Pittsburgh US., * The Workplace Technology Infrastructure Engineer is responsible for designing, implementing, and supporting endpoint and desktop management automation solutions across the enterprise. This role focuses on software automation, Group Policy management, browser configuration management, and login script administration to improve operational efficiency, security, and end-user experience.

  • Build and maintain endpoint management solutions for software installation, upgrades, and removals.
  • Design and maintain automation solutions for software deployment, patching, and configuration management.
  • Administer and optimize Group Policy Objects (GPOs) for enterprise desktop and server environments.
  • Manage enterprise browser configurations, policies, extensions, and compliance settings.
  • Develop, test, and maintain login scripts that map drives, configure environment settings, and support user onboarding needs.
  • Analyze incidents related to desktop policies, browser performance, and software delivery.
  • Understanding of registry management, user profiles, and Windows logon processes.
  • Collaborate with engineering and operations teams to ensure solutions are reliable and scalable.
  • Experience with software deployment lifecycle and operational support.
  • Troubleshoot endpoint management, policy conflicts, software packaging, and deployment issues.
  • Partner with infrastructure, cybersecurity, and application teams to enforce standards and controls.
  • Document operational procedures, configurations, standards, and automation runbooks.
  • Support change management, release activities, and production issue resolution.
  • Identify opportunities to reduce manual effort through scripting and automation.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field, or equivalent experience.
  • 5+ years of experience in endpoint engineering, desktop engineering, or infrastructure automation.
  • Hands-on experience with scripting tools such as PowerShell, VBScript, or batch scripting.
  • Group Policy administration
  • Software packaging and deployment tools
  • Browser policy management for Chrome, Edge, and/or Firefox
  • Login script creation and troubleshooting
  • Experience with Windows enterprise environments and Active Directory.
  • Str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ills.
  • Experience with Intune, MECM/SCCM, or similar endpoint management platforms.
  • Familiarity with cybersecurity controls and endpoint hardening.
  • Experience with enterprise-scale change and release processes.
  • Knowledge of identity/access integrations and user profile management.
